Oregon State Combat Robotics club is a student-led organization at Oregon State University, and Winter Wars '22 is our first event of the 2021-2022 season.
The aim of OSCR is bringing hands-on robotics education and experience to OSU students of all disciplines. Members learn basic design and development principles of combat robotics, then use that knowledge to print and build their own 1-pound Plastic Antweight combat robots. The culmination of the Plastic Antweight program is a robot combat event where members can showcase their creations.
OSCR's combat arena is 5ft x 5ft x 4ft with a metal floor and kickplates. It also has a corner pit that opens when one-minute is remains of the three-minute bouts, there are no other OOTA areas. The arena is capable of safely containing 1-pound, all-metal combat robots.
Winter Wars '22 is open to the public and the following weight classes in double-elimination format: 150 gram fairyweight, 1-pound metal antweight and 1-pound plastic antweight. This event is SPARC Compliant, https://clubs.oregonstate.edu/combat-robotics/sparc
